In the sub instance make sure this is set to No:
Data/Trade Service Settings: Allow Support for Sierra Chart Data Feeds (Global Settings >> Data/Trade Service Settings >> Common Settings >> Common Other Settings)

In the sub instance disable Use Custom Symbol Settings Values:
Global Symbol Settings: Disabling Custom Symbol Settings

In the sub instance follow the instructions here to update the Symbol Settings:
Global Symbol Settings: Update Global Symbol Settings

Re-download all the data in the chart by going to the chart and selecting "Edit >> Delete All Data and Download" from the main Sierra Chart menu. You just need to do this once per symbol and not for each chart. This command is on the main Sierra Chart menu at the top. Only use it from that location.
